The Spin

Pro-Palestine narrative

NYU's unconscionable persecution of a brave graduate speaking on behalf of Palestinian rights exposes the hollow facade of academic freedom. By punishing truthful speech about Gaza's humanitarian catastrophe, administrators reveal their cowardice — silencing conscience while hypocritically championing free expression elsewhere. This shameful inquisition against moral courage joins a disturbing pattern of institutional repression, where earned credentials become hostages to ideological compliance rather than rewards for academic achievement.

Pro-establishment narrative

NYU was right to act. Rozos willfully deceived the university, weaponized a shared moment of celebration to promote inflammatory falsehoods, and violated clear rules on antisemitism and Israel. Commencements are not soapboxes for political provocation — especially not for rhetoric echoing extremist propaganda. NYU's response is a principled stand for truth, integrity, and the safety and dignity of its entire campus community.
